MACHINE WASHING
If your curtains are fully machine washable (check the label care instructions), you can carefully perform the cleaning yourself. Decide on to let them dry in the air after they have been through a gentle machine wash cycle. Be certain while they are still somewhat damp, then hang them up immediately to reduce wrinkling, that you iron your curtains. DRY CLEANING CURTAINS
Curtains that are made of lace, linen or other fabrics will need to be dry cleaned. The reason for this is the hot water, detergent and constant rubbing action in the washing machine may result in damage such as shrinking or fading. WHEN WILL A CURTAIN REQUIRE MORE FREQUENT CLEANING?

While cleaning your curtains every 3 to 6 months should be appropriate for household requirements, we would advocate more frequent cleaning if these factors play a role in your home:
Allergies
Curtains can trap many different common allergens including mold spores, pollen, dust, pet hair and dander. If you or a relative suffers from allergies, regular curtain and rug cleaning needs to be a part of your family routine.
Smoking
Particles from pipes, cigars and cigarettes are trapped in drapes fabric. If you do not need to create your curtains yellow or have a smell of smoke inside your home, make sure you allow lots of air in and clean your curtains every month if possible.
